There are two tragedies in life. One is to lose your heart's desire. The other is to gain it.
- George Bernard Shaw
The best way to find yourself is to lose yourself in the service of others.
- Mahatma Gandhi

Perhaps only people who are capable of real togetherness have that look of being alone in the universe. The others have a certain stickiness, they stick to the mass.
- D. H. Lawrence
Music, when combined with a pleasurable idea, is poetry; Music, without the idea, is simply music; the idea, without the music, is prose, from its very definitiveness.
- Edgar Allan Poe
